The SF Fed Workplace Experience + Law Enforcement team is looking for a Senior Executive Assistant to join our team. We bring contemporary thinking and a risk-based approach to the table to solve problems and move the SF Fed forward. In this role you will support the Group Vice President, and work closely with the Workplace Experience + Law Enforcement operations team as well as the Phoenix office team members.

Highlights of Responsibilities

  • Provide executive support to the SF Fed Group Vice President with oversight of Workplace Experience + Law Enforcement group and the Phoenix office.

  • Coordinate meetings with other executives (internal and external), including meeting materials and communications.

  • Support with secretariat duties associated with enterprise-level committees, including agenda coordination, collection of briefing materials, correspondence, compilation of data for reports, and logistical support.

  • In partnership with the group vice president and team, maintain ad-hoc projects and ensure key collaborators and colleagues are following through on tasks and commitments.

  • Collaborate with other groups (internal and external) and Reserve Banks to plan meetings and conferences.

  • Coordinate travel arrangements and expense reports.

  • Support team members by assisting with office space planning and purchasing supplies.

Qualifications

  • AA degree or equivalent work experience as an executive assistant

  • Typically, minimum of 6 years related work experience

  • Able to communicate across levels within organization

  • Solid understanding of MS PowerPoint, Excel, Word and Outlook

  • Able to work both independently and with a team

  • Able to multi-task, maintain attention to detail, and maintain a professional demeanor and positive demeanor.

Base Salary Range: Min: $63,400, Mid: $82,300, Max: $101,400 (Location: Phoenix).

Final salary and offer will be determined by the applicant’s background, experience, skills, internal equity, and alignment with market data.

The Federal Reserve is the central bank of the United States—one of the world's most influential, trusted and prestigious financial organizations. The Federal Reserve is charged with the important mission of promoting a strong economy and a stable financial system and fulfills this responsibility by formulating national monetary policy, supervising and regulating banks and bank holding companies, and providing financial services for banks and the U.S. government.
